Vicosa vs Chaiyaphum Climate & Distance Between

Thailand flag
  • The distance between Vicosa, Brazil and Chaiyaphum, Thailand is approximately 16,274 km or 10,113 mi.
  • To reach Vicosa in this distance one would set out from Chaiyaphum bearing 256.2° or WSW and follow the great circles arc to approach Vicosa bearing 272.5° or W .
  • Vicosa has a humid subtropical climate with dry winters (Cwa) whereas Chaiyaphum has a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ry winters (Aw).
  • Vicosa is in or near the subtropical moist forest biome whereas Chaiyaphum is in or near the tropical dry forest biome.
  • The annual average temperature is 7.8 °C (14°F) cooler.
  • Average monthly temperatures vary by 0.6 °C (1.1°F) more in Vicosa. The continentality subtype is truly hyperoceanic for both.
  • Total annual precipitation averages 68.4 mm (2.7 in) more which is equivalent to 68.4 l/m² (1.68 US gal/ft²) or 684,000 l/ha (73,124 US gal/ac) more. About 1 as much.
  • The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 3.7° lower in Vicosa than in Chaiyaphum.
